Publication number: 20180372978Abstract: A fiber optic cassette includes a housing with a base and a cover. The base defines an open front between first and second sidewalls, which transition into first and second curved rear wall portions. The first and second curved rear wall portions define an adapter mount therebetween forming at least one pocket. A signal entry location defined by at least one MPO adapter is positioned within the pocket and defines an exterior port and an interior port. A fiber optic cable connectorized by an MPO format connector is mated to the exterior port. Publication number: 20180259738Abstract: Securing a cable to a panel includes assembling a cable clamp arrangement to a cable and mounting the cable clamp arrangement to the panel. Assembling the cable clamp arrangement includes disposing a grommet around an exterior surface of the cable; disposing a yoke around the grommet so that the yoke at least partially surrounds the grommet; and compressing the yoke and grommet between a bracket and a backing plate using a fastener so that the cable is compressed. Mounting the cable clamp arrangement to the panel includes sliding the bracket relative to the panel in a direction parallel to a surface of the panel until the bracket rests on fasteners extending from the panel. Publication number: 20180129006Abstract: A fiber optic telecommunications device includes a frame and a fiber optic module including a rack mount portion, a center portion, and a main housing portion. The rack mount portion is stationarily coupled to the frame, the center portion is slidably coupled to the rack mount portion along a sliding direction, and the main housing portion is slidably coupled to the center portion along the sliding direction. The main housing portion of the fiber optic module includes fiber optic connection locations for connecting cables to be routed through the frame. The center portion of the fiber optic module includes a radius limiter for guiding cables between the main housing portion and the frame, the center portion also including a latch for unlatching the center portion for slidable movement. Patent number: 9939601Abstract: A self-locking cable clamp arrangement includes a bracket and a flexible tab disposed on the bracket. The bracket has a cable mounting region, a first engagement region, and a support region disposed therebetween. A cable can be clamped to the cable mounting region. The support region defining two members spaced apart sufficient to enable an edge of the panel to extend partially therebetween. The flexible tab can be selectively coupled to the cable mounting region and to the first engagement region. Patent number: 9348105Abstract: A splice chip includes a base, separation members extending upwardly from the base to define a plurality of rows, and latching fingers extending upwardly from the base to further define the rows. At least one of the rows includes at least a first latching finger, a second latching finger, and a third latching finger. The third latching finger is shorter than the first and second latching fingers. The second latching finger is shorter than the first latching finger.
